Social War (24 gen 91 anni a. C. – 24 gen 88 anni a. C.)
Descrizione:
The Social War also known as the Italian War, was a war for Italian enfranchisement. Several cities of the Roman Republic rebel against Rome, the purpose being to achieve citizenship for the Italian people. Before this war only Roman citizens were entitled to citizenship as a birth right. The war ends with concessions made by Rome to the wider confederation leading to citizenship for all Latin and Italian communities that did not revolt. This war importantly sees the rise of Sulla at its conclusion.
